Syzygy Plasmonics
Houston, US · Founded 2018 · Delaware corporation · 6 known investors
Syzygy Plasmonics converts waste biogas and renewable electricity into sustainable aviation fuel using proprietary photocatalytic technology. The company serves airlines and fuel buyers seeking low-carbon alternatives to conventional jet fuel.
Founders & leadership
Syzygy Plasmonics was founded in 2018 by Suman Khatiwada and Trevor Best.
